Anne (Diane Lane) is an American woman who is in a strained marriage with a workaholic movie producer husband (Alec Baldwin). One day, she unexpectedly finds herself on a road trip from Cannes to Paris with a dashing business associate of her husband. What should have been a seven-hour drive turns into a two-day adventure that reawakens Anne’s passion for life.
Director: Eleanor Coppola
Studio: Lifetime Films
Producer(s): Fred Roos
Cast: Diane Lane, Arnaud Viard, Alec Baldwin
Writer(s): Eleanor Coppola
